FireWolves bested by Bandits in game one of NLL Finals
Game 1 of the National Lacrosse League (NLL) Finals lived up to expectations, as the rival Albany FireWolves and Buffalo Bandits went blow-for-blow through three quarters. But the defending champion Bandits showed their championship resolve, pulling away in the fourth stanza, en route to a 12-8 win in front of a raucous crowd at MVP Arena.
Quintez Cephus: Time up in Buffalo
The Bills cut Cephus on Thursday. Cephus landed with Buffalo back in April after having missed the entire 2023 season for violating the league's gambling policy. Now, the 2020 fifth-round pick will have to search for a chance to reignite his career with another club. He suited up for 22 regular-season games with the Lions from 2020-22.

Tug softball finishes as sectional runner-ups, closes out 20-win season
BUFFALO – It was quite a ride for the Tug Valley High School softball team. But the 2024 season came to an end on Wednesday, May 8 as the Lady Panthers lost 5-1 at Buffalo in the Class A Region 4 Section 1 championship game at Buffalo High School's turfed Darrell Moore Field.
